Mobile Car Washes in Lucas End, Hertfordshire

loading search form
286 Car Washes · Lucas End, Hertfordshire



Ashclean

42 Winterscroft Road, Hoddesdon, Hertfordshire, EN11 8RJ

Distance: 20.04 miles

View

Reeves

21 Tamar Close, St. Ives, Cambridgeshire, PE27 3JD

Distance: 20.64 miles

View

Ivalet Uk

26 Rosemary Road, Cambridge, Cambridgeshire, CB25 9NB

Distance: 21.14 miles

View

121 – 140 of 286 Businesses found

286 Car Washes · Lucas End, Hertfordshire